Key Differences
EZPACE (A) features 3M Thinsulate insulation, anti-slip palm grip, and sherpa fleece lining, and has a higher review count with a 4.60 rating; The Drop (B) focuses on a warm, fluffy faux-fur aesthetic with a softer, stylish look but lower rating and fewer reviews. Choose A for insulated, grip-oriented mitten performance and more-reviewed reliability; choose B if you prioritize a whimsical faux-fur style and fluffy feel
